Acromegaly
A hormonal disorder that results from too much growth hormone in the body, leading to enlarged bones in hands, feet, and face.
Growth Hormone
A hormone produced by the pituitary gland that stimulates growth, cell reproduction, and cell regeneration in humans and other animals.
Hyperthyroidism
A condition where the thyroid gland produces too much thyroid hormone, leading to accelerated metabolism and various systemic symptoms.
